A MAN in his 40s has died following a single vehicle crash on Saturday.

Police are appealing for any witnesses to the incident, which happened on the A67 near Eaglescliffe at about 1.25pm.

The crash involved a blue Vauxhall Astra, which crashed underneath the rail bridge east of Urlay Nook Road on the westbound carriageway.

The driver suffered serious injuries and has since died in hospital.

A police spokesperson said: “Our thoughts are with the victim’s family at this difficult time.”

Officers are asking for anyone who witnessed the collision, may have captured vehicle on dash cam footage or may have witnessed the vehicle prior to the collision to contact PC Andrew Lawson via the non-emergency number 101, quoting the reference number 025570.
